About Steelcore

A Professional, End-to-End Approach to Shed Construction

Steelcore Sheds was established in 2024 to provide a more professional, end-to-end approach to shed supply and construction across the Hunter Valley and surrounding areas.

Founded by Jason Moore, Steelcore was built on 12 years of hands-on experience in shed construction and project delivery.

Over that time, Jason has worked extensively across residential, rural and commercial projects, gaining a detailed understanding of engineering requirements, council approvals, slab design coordination and on site installation.

The business was created in response to a common problem in the industry, clients being left to manage engineers, council paperwork and subcontractors themselves. Steelcore was designed to remove that stress by providing one point of responsibility from initial concept through to final handover.

Unlike companies that outsource installation to unknown subcontractors, our builds are delivered by a consistent, experienced team with a proven track record across residential, rural and commercial projects. This ensures strong quality control, clear communication and accountability from start to finish.

It depends on size, location, height and use. Some sheds can be built under Complying Development (CDC) without full council approval, while others require a Development Application (DA). We help assess your site and coordinate approvals where required.
